Serial block at CBS-TV in by comedy reruns and ■ Sales staff for CBS-TV's highrated daytime lineup, headed by Joe Curl, sells "Morning Minutes" in pre-noon lineup of news and comedy reruns, shifts to segment selling in afternoon lineup of serialized dramas and game shows. In Nielsen's second report for November. 1964. CBS led the field with a solid ten out of the top ten daytime shows, with As The World Turns in first place. Most daytime blue-chip sponsors place business with CBS, but network is making efforts to develop new business among beer companies, autos. insurance firms, cigarets.
